titleOfInvention | Lithographic printing plate substrate, lithographic printing plate, and method of manufacturing lithographic printing plate |
abstract | (57) [Summary] [Problem] To provide a lithographic printing plate substrate with excellent printing durability and with a non-image portion resistant to contamination without special conditions, and a lithographic printing plate using the substrate and a method of manufacturing a lithographic printing plate. . In a lithographic printing plate substrate comprising a support and a hydrophilic layer provided thereon, the hydrophilic layer contains a microgel and optionally contains inorganic fine particles. An image-forming material is adhered imagewise to the surface of the hydrophilic layer by an ink-jet method, and an lipophilic image layer composed of the image-forming material is formed on at least a part of the surface of the hydrophilic layer. On the surface of the heat-sensitive layer, the heat-sensitive transfer layer of a heat-sensitive transfer sheet comprising a heat-sensitive transfer layer provided in the form of a sheet is brought into close contact with the heat-sensitive transfer layer, and then heated from the heat-sensitive transfer sheet side in an image-like manner. Transferring a heat-sensitive transfer layer corresponding to the heated portion to form a lipophilic image layer composed of the heat-sensitive transfer layer on at least a part of the surface of the hydrophilic layer. The lithographic printing plate obtained above. |
